ENDA Markup Postponed
Posted by Mara Keisling at 10:07 PM

http://nctequality.blogspot.com/2009/11/enda-markup-postponed.html

Chairman George Miller of the House Education and Labor Committee temporarily postponed Wednesday's mark up on the Employment Non-Discrimination Act (ENDA) in order to finalize some legal and technical issues with the bill. A new date will be set after the Thanksgiving recess.

Attorneys and advocates from NCTE and other the LGBT organizations have been working closely with committee staff on the legal aspects of the bill; in fact, we're talking with them daily. There are still a few technicalities that do need to be finalized before a successful mark up can be held. Those supporting the bill, including Chairman Miller, want to ensure that, once passed, ENDA will absolutely stand up in a court of law, and be as airtight as possible, so that even conservative anti-LGBT judges won't find it easy to whittle away at ENDA.
